Zebra Obliquidens

Haplochromis latifasciatus

The Zebra Obliquidens Cichlid is native to the lakes of Uganda, and lake Nawampasa, near lake Victoria. It is a semi aggressive fish that should be kept with similar tank mates.

The Zebra Obliquidens Cichlid requires a tank of at least 200 litres or more with plenty of rocks for territories and a gravel substrate planted with hardy plants, as with most cichlids, they are prolific redecorators and will arrange plants how they see fit. The Zebra Obliquidens does best in a species tank and should be kept with similar-sized fish. It can be kept successfully with tilapia, mbuna, or haps of similar disposition

The Zebra Obliquidens Cichlid will accept a variety of meaty and vegetarian foods. Live foods like brine shrimp should be offered sporadically. A quality flake and tablet food containing vegetable matter should also be included in their diet.

The Zebra Obliquidens can be bred in the home aquarium. They are mouth brooders with the female carrying the fry, of which there may be 100, for around 3 - 4 weeks.

Fish Statistics

Minimum Tank Size:
200 litres
Diet:
Omnivore
Origin:
Lake Victoria
Temp (C):
22-27 C
Max Size:
15cm
Family:
Cichlidae
Temperament:
Semi-aggressive
pH:
7.5 - 8.5
Care Level:
Easy
